JNIEXPORT jint JNICALL Java_org_puredata_core_PdBase_sendControlChange (JNIEnv *env, jclass cls, jint channel, jint controller, jint value) { pthread_mutex_lock(&mutex); int err = libpd_controlchange(channel, controller, value); pthread_mutex_unlock(&mutex); return err; }
void PdBase::sendControlChange(const int channel, const int control, const int value) { libpd_controlchange(channel, control, value); }
void PdBase::sendControlChange(const int channel, const int controller, const int value) { _LOCK(); libpd_controlchange(channel, controller, value); _UNLOCK(); }